CASPASE‑8 supports T cell survival through mechanisms beyond repressing RIPK1‑dependent necroptosis. Conditional deletion studies reveal its essential role in CD8⁺ T cell maintenance and NKT cell development.

Type‑17 immunity shows up in the gut: axSpA stool contains increased IL‑17A, IL‑23 & GM‑CSF, alongside systemic Th17 activation.

Metabolomics points to microbial metabolic links.

High‑throughput long‑read sequencing uncovers how chickens diversify their Ig genes: dominant somatic gene conversion, biased pseudogene usage, and focused CDR‑targeted insertions.

Oligodendrocytes do more than make myelin β€” they actively shape immune responses in the CNS.

Pasquini & Correale reveal how OGDs can present antigens, modulate microglia, and balance pro- & anti-inflammatory signals.

Spermidine can suppress dendritic cell activation by regulating metabolism via eIF5A hypusination, reducing T cell interactions. Immune regulation or pathogen exploitation?
